Elex - About the company

Elex is an acquired company based in Beijing (China), founded in 2008 by Binsen Tang. It operates as a Social Games developer targeting mobile and browser platforms. Elex has raised $3M in funding. The company has 1226 active competitors, including 136 funded and 125 that have exited. Its top competitors include companies like LINE Games, Supercell and Linekong.

Company Details

ELEX (also Elex Tech) is a Chinese Social Games developer and publisher targeting Mobile and Browser platforms. Their popular games include Clash of Kings - a mobile real time strategy (RTS) game and Age of Warring Empire - a mobile strategy game integrated with RPG elements.
